In the heart of Paris Roissy-CDG airport, an exclusive new relaxation area opens its doors to Emirates travelers. An invitation to relaxation and comfort before taking off to new destinations.
A substantial investment in passenger comfort

Emirates has invested over 3.5 million AED (864,000 euros) for the development of its new Terminal 2C at Paris Roissy-CDG airport. The new space is designed to offer customers a perfect blend of comfort and convenience.
Capacity and modern design
The show can accommodate up to 165 guests. Each of them will enjoy a modern design with brand new furniture. Comfortable armchairs and sofas are available for a pleasant pre-flight experience.
Premium facilities and services
Show facilities include showers equipped with VOYA productsa Wi-Fi free of chargeas well as a breathtaking view of the runway of the airport. These elements are designed to guarantee comfort and relaxation for travelers.
A varied gastronomic offer
In terms of gastronomy, the Emirates lounge offers a wide variety of dishes and beverages. Guests can enjoy local specialties, including dishes such as :
- Pan-fried fillet of beef with Béarnaise sauce
- Poached cod fillet with sauce vierge
- Cheese platters
- Refined desserts
Customers can also choose from high-quality spirits and liqueursa selection of French wines and Moët & Chandon champagnes.
Emirates' commitment to passenger well-being
The new lounge underlines Emirates' commitment to providing high-quality travel experiences to its French customers. The airline currently has 39 trade fairs worldwideincluding seven in Dubai and 32 at other major international airports.
